How To Watch Muse In FranceWithout Even Being There

From the captain:

Tom Kirk


Muse will be on stage in Paris for Live 8 at 17:40 French time. As mentioned above the AOL broadcast will show the whole event from France. We are still trying to find out if this stream will be immediately live or slightly delayed. As far as the BBC broadcast goes, we are pretty hopeful we are going to feature on this. Stay tuned. Sorry for the pun.